Driveway edging repair services involve restoring and maintaining the boundary between a driveway and adjacent landscaping or lawn areas. Over time, the edging materials-such as concrete, brick, stone, or metal-can become damaged, cracked, or displaced due to regular use, weather conditions, or ground shifting. Repair work typically includes replacing broken sections, realigning misaligned edges, and sealing gaps to ensure a clean, defined border. Properly maintained driveway edging not only enhances curb appeal but also helps prevent soil erosion and weed intrusion, keeping the property looking neat and well-kept.
Many common problems signal the need for driveway edging repair. Cracks or crumbling sections may appear as the ground settles or as materials age and weaken. Edging that has shifted or become uneven can create tripping hazards or make the driveway look unkempt. In some cases, the edging may be completely displaced or broken, allowing grass or weeds to invade the driveway space. These issues can lead to further deterioration if left unaddressed, resulting in more extensive repairs down the line. The overview below groups typical Driveway Edging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lebanon,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or driveway edging repairs cost between $250 and $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, especially for straightforward crack repairs or small sections. Larger or more complex repairs can push costs higher but are less common.
Partial Edging Replacement - Replacing a section of driveway edging usually ranges from $600 to $1,200. Many projects in this category are moderate in scope, with fewer cases reaching the upper end of this range for extensive work.
Full Driveway Edging Replacement - Complete replacement of driveway edging often costs between $1,200 and $3,000. Larger, more involved projects can exceed this range but are less frequently encountered for typical residential driveways.
Custom or Complex Projects - Highly detailed or extensive driveway edging projects can cost $3,000 or more. These are less common and usually involve unique materials or design features that increase overall cost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
